Track 01
Innovations in Cloud Computing Architectures

This track focuses on the latest advancements in cloud computing architectures that enhance scalability and performance. It aims to explore novel designs and frameworks that facilitate efficient resource management in cloud environments.

Track 02
Big Data Analytics Techniques

This session will delve into advanced analytics techniques specifically tailored for big data environments. Researchers are invited to present methodologies that improve data interpretation and decision-making processes.

Track 03
Distributed Systems for Big Data Processing

This track addresses the challenges and solutions associated with distributed systems in processing large datasets. Contributions should highlight innovative approaches that optimize data distribution and processing efficiency.

Track 04
Machine Learning Applications in Cloud Environments

This session explores the integration of machine learning algorithms within cloud computing platforms. Papers should discuss practical applications and the impact of AI-driven solutions on cloud-based data analytics.

Track 05
Data Governance and Security in Cloud Computing

This track examines the critical aspects of data governance and security in cloud environments. Contributions should address frameworks and policies that ensure data integrity and compliance in cloud applications.

Track 06
Scalable Computing Solutions for Big Data

This session focuses on scalable computing solutions that address the growing demands of big data applications. Researchers are encouraged to present innovative techniques that enhance computational scalability and efficiency.

Track 07
Cloud Platforms for Data Integration

This track investigates the role of cloud platforms in facilitating seamless data integration across diverse sources. Papers should highlight strategies and tools that enhance interoperability and data coherence.

Track 08
AI-Driven Cloud Solutions for Data-Driven Innovation

This session explores how AI-driven solutions can foster data-driven innovation within cloud computing frameworks. Contributions should focus on case studies and applications that demonstrate the transformative potential of AI in cloud environments.

Track 09
Optimization Techniques for Cloud Applications

This track addresses optimization strategies for enhancing the performance of cloud applications. Researchers are invited to present novel algorithms and methodologies that improve resource utilization and application responsiveness.

Track 10
Challenges in Cloud Infrastructure Management

This session focuses on the challenges associated with managing cloud infrastructure in the context of big data applications. Contributions should discuss best practices and innovative solutions for effective infrastructure management.

Track 11
Future Trends in Cloud Computing and Big Data

This track aims to explore emerging trends and future directions in cloud computing and big data technologies. Researchers are encouraged to speculate on the evolution of these fields and their potential impact on various industries.
